Oyster Dressing Divine

Directions

  1. 1
    Preheat oven to 350 degrees. Butter 10 x 14" shallow baking dish.
  2. 2
    In a large skillet, cook bacon over moderate heat until crisp, about 5 minutes. Add butter and allow to melt, then add celery, green pepper, onion, and minced garlic and cook until softened, about 8 minutes. Add paprika, garlic powder, and vayenne, and cook for 3 minutes, stirring occasionally.
  3. 3
    Put the baguette cubes in a large bowl. Spoon the bacon mixture on top. Add the oysters and thei liquor along with chicken broth, scallions, and parsley.
  4. 4
    In a small bowl, beat eggs with the hot sauce and salt. Pour the egg mixture into the bowl and mix everything together. Scrape the dressing into the prepared dish and bake in the upper 1/3 of oven for about 45 minutes, until heated through and crisp on top. Serve hot.
  5. 5
    May be made ahead, baked and refirgerated overnight. Reheat before serving.
